Course # 7610 - Clinical Ophthalmology for Non-Specialists

Prerequisite

Senior medical students or junior medical students doing their senior rotation.

Rotation

These two-week elective students will spend each working day with an ophthalmologist giving an in-depth exposure to diagnosis and treatment of common eye problems. This rotation will be with a COMMUNITY ophthalmologist and will not be at the Moran Eye Center. Please contact Alicia Doxon for a list of participating physicians.
